Ho Chi Minh City International Martial Arts Festival 2025: Spreading the message of peace

On the morning of November 7, the Department of Culture and Sports of Ho Chi Minh City held a press conference to introduce the Ho Chi Minh City International Martial Arts Festival 2025, with the theme "Vietnamese Martial Arts - Connecting Peace".

Introducing the image of "city for peace , city of martial arts and creativity"

The Ho Chi Minh City International Martial Arts Festival, with the theme "Vietnamese Martial Arts - Connecting Peace" is an annual international sports and cultural event organized by the Department of Culture and Sports. The festival is held to honor the martial spirit of Vietnam, promote the image of a country that loves peace, humanity and integration; at the same time, expand international exchanges, promote cooperation in the fields of sports, culture and tourism between Vietnam and friends around the world.

The event is not only a festival of martial arts but also a forum for global cultural exchange, where the quintessence of Vietnamese martial arts is connected with international martial arts. Through the festival, Ho Chi Minh City affirms its pioneering role in building a civilized, modern, dynamic and humane city, while introducing the image of "a city for peace, a city of martial arts and creativity" to friends around the world .

The Ho Chi Minh City International Martial Arts Festival takes place from November 21 to 23, on Le Loi Street, Saigon Ward, Ho Chi Minh City. This year's event is expected to attract international martial arts delegations from: Korea, China, India, France, Poland, the Philippines, Thailand, Cambodia, Indonesia and more than 20 domestic martial arts delegations, along with thousands of martial arts masters, coaches, students and martial arts lovers.

The opening ceremony of the event took place on November 21, with a martial arts performance combining traditional arts, modern sound and light. The International Martial Arts Festival took place on November 22 and 23, with performances of forms, techniques and ensemble performances of Vietnamese schools/disciplines. The closing event on the evening of November 23: honoring outstanding martial artists and excellent troupes; performing the art "Vietnamese martial arts spirit - from Ho Chi Minh City spreading the quintessence to the world".

In addition to taekwondo, karate, aikido, kendo, wushu... typical Vietnamese martial arts such as vovinam, Tan Khanh Ba Tra, Tay Son Binh Dinh, Hung Gia qigong will also be performed for martial arts fans to enjoy.

Notably, on the morning of November 22, Le Loi Street was also the place where the departure ceremony of the Vietnamese sports delegation from the southern region to participate in the 33rd SEA Games in Thailand took place. The departure ceremony was integrated with a special meaning, encouraging and raising the spirit of the city's athletes on their journey to conquer the 33rd SEA Games.
